The JavaScript client previously skipped signature verification on cached responses; version 4.2 closes that gap, so treat anything earlier as non-compliant. Parity is gated by a shared conformance suite run against the Hallowmere staging tenant, and both SDKs must pass all signing cases. Both clients read their security posture from the configuration values shown below.

service settings:
PRAIX_LOG_LEVEL=error
PRAIX_METRICS_HOST=metrics.praix.qorvelcorp.corp
PRAIX_POOL_SIZE=16

## Authentication

Glazemap's tile-rendering cache (Kilnshard) requires auth on every request. No anonymous reads. Plugin authors must register through the Glazemap dev portal and request cache-tier scope; render-tier scope is internal only. Tokens are per-plugin, non-transferable, and rate-limited to 600 requests per minute. Rotate every 90 days or the gateway rejects you with a 403. Do not embed credentials in distributed plugin bundles; load from config at runtime. For local testing against the sandbox cache, use the key below.

service key, fafop-kaguf: vxb7-m3DSNYe

## Service Accounts — StormFan Alert Fan-Out

The fan-out worker authenticates to the internal dispatch tier using the svc-stormfan account. Rotate quarterly; scopes are limited to publish-only on alert topics. If deliveries stall during your shift, verify the worker is using the current credential, reproduced below for reference.

API key for kaweg-hahif: kto4_rAjZ

Request tracing in the Larkfield platform relies on the trace header injected by the Gatewright edge proxy. Every downstream service must propagate it unchanged, or spans will orphan in the Spanloom collector. If you see gaps in a trace, check the Pellar queue workers first; they historically dropped headers during retries. Span retention is fourteen days. The full propagation matrix and troubleshooting flowchart live on the internal page below.

dashboard of bafof-hafog = https://confluence.lumiclabs.internal/display/browse/display/6a09a20a